IT Coordinator
United School of Panama · Panama
Job description
About the role
The United School of Panama is seeking a proactive, service‑oriented IT Coordinator to manage and support its technology ecosystem. The role involves overseeing the school’s IT infrastructure, providing day‑to‑day technical support, and planning future technology investments in a dynamic educational environment.
Key responsibilities
- Manage and maintain networks, Wi‑Fi, hardware, software, printers, classroom technology and related systems.
- Provide timely technical support and troubleshooting to faculty, staff and students.
- Administer user accounts, access permissions, device inventory and technology assets.
- Support integration and administration of educational and operational technology platforms.
- Monitor network performance, system security, backups and data protection practices.
- Coordinate installation, configuration, maintenance and upgrades of IT equipment and systems.
- Develop, manage and monitor the annual IT budget aligned with strategic priorities.
- Plan technology investments, equipment replacements, software licences and infrastructure upgrades.
- Handle IT purchasing, procurement, vendor quotations and cost‑effective solutions.
- Manage relationships, contracts and service agreements with technology vendors and external providers.
- Maintain accurate documentation of assets, licences, warranties, systems and procedures.
- Support technology‑related projects and promote responsible, secure use of technology across the school community.
Required profile
- Degree or technical qualification in Information Technology, Computer Science, Systems Engineering or a related field.
- Previous experience in IT support, systems administration, network management or a similar role.
- Strong knowledge of networking, hardware, software, troubleshooting and cybersecurity fundamentals.
- Experience with IT budgeting, purchasing, inventory management and vendor coordination (highly desirable).
- Experience managing Apple devices and educational technology environments (advantage).
- Excellent communication, interpersonal skills and a collaborative, customer‑service mindset.
- English proficiency is required.
